About this episode

This episode discusses the IEEPA tariffs imposed by the Trump administration and their implications on international trade.

The International Emergency Economic Powers Act (IEEPA) tariffs were additional duties imposed by the Trump administration starting in early 2025, primarily using IEEPA's emergency powers to address issues like fentanyl trafficking, immigration, and trade deficits. These included "fentanyl" or "trafficking" tariffs on imports from countries such as China, Canada, and Mexico, as well as broader "reciprocal" or "baseline" tariffs (often 10% or higher) applied to goods from many trading partners...
